Why Methi Dana ki Sabji is Great for Kids

Getting your kids to eat healthy meals can be tricky, but Methi Dana ki Sabji is a fantastic choice for introducing them to nutritious ingredients. Fenugreek seeds (methi dana) contain fibre, vitamins, and minerals that promote digestion, boost immunity, and support overall growth.

This dish is a wonderful addition to your parenting toolkit. Whether you follow a health-focused parenting style or prefer to indulge your little one’s taste buds, this sabji can be customised to meet their needs. Its slightly sweet and tangy flavour appeals to kids, and the fun textures make eating exciting—perfect for encouraging adventurous eating habits.

Key Nutrients in Methi Dana ki Sabji

Methi Dana ki Sabji is brimming with essential nutrients that help kids grow strong and stay active:

  • Fibre: Aids digestion and prevents tummy troubles.

  • Iron: Boosts haemoglobin production and supports brain development.

  • Vitamin C: Enhances immunity and keeps your child healthy.

  • Calcium: Helps build strong bones and teeth.

  • Antioxidants: Protect the body from harmful free radicals.

Ingredients You’ll Need

Here’s what you need to whip up a kid-friendly version of Methi Dana ki Sabji:

  • 2 tablespoons methi dana (fenugreek seeds)

  • 1 cup diced potatoes or peas (for added flavour and variety)

  • 2 teaspoons jaggery or honey (a natural sweetener)

  • 1 small tomato (finely chopped)

  • 1 teaspoon ghee or oil

  • A pinch of turmeric

  • A pinch of salt

This simple list ensures even busy parents can create a nutritious meal in no time, fitting perfectly into any parenting style.

Step-by-Step Instructions to Make Methi Dana ki Sabji

  1. Step 1: Soak the Seeds

    Rinse the methi dana thoroughly and soak them in water for 6–8 hours (or overnight). This reduces bitterness and makes the seeds tender—perfect for your little one’s palate.

  2. Step 2: Prepare the Base

    Heat ghee or oil in a pan. Add a pinch of turmeric and the chopped tomato. Cook until the tomato softens, creating a flavourful base.

  3. Step 3: Add the Potatoes or Peas

    Add diced potatoes or peas and sauté for a few minutes. These ingredients balance the flavours and make the dish more appealing to kids.

  4. Step 4: Cook the Methi Dana

    Drain the soaked methi dana and add them to the pan. Mix well and let everything cook together for about 10–12 minutes, stirring occasionally.

  5. Step 5: Sweeten and Serve

    Add jaggery or honey and a pinch of salt. Mix until the jaggery melts and coats the ingredients. Serve warm with roti or rice.

Customisation Tips for Every Parenting Style

No matter your approach to parenting, this sabzi can be tailored to suit your family’s needs:

  • For indulgent parents: Add a small handful of grated cheese for an extra creamy twist that kids will love.

  • For health-conscious parents: Skip the potatoes and opt for more greens like spinach or peas for added nutrients.

  • For busy parents: Prepare the soaked methi dana in advance and refrigerate it for up to two days. This makes the cooking process quicker.
